Role Overview
This onsite full-time position as a Hotel Receptionist at Radisson Blu in At Tahliyah District, Eastern Saudi Arabia, involves warmly welcoming guests upon arrival, managing check-in and check-out procedures, and delivering prompt and courteous front desk assistance. The receptionist will coordinate room bookings and modifications, handle incoming phone calls professionally, respond to guest inquiries, facilitate communication with other hotel departments, and ensure smooth daily operations. Responsibilities also include processing payments, maintaining accurate guest records, and addressing concerns with empathy and professionalism. Maintaining Radisson Blu's service standards and a polished reception area is critical to fostering a positive guest experience.
Qualifications and Skills
- Excellent interpersonal skills, focused on guest hospitality and courteous service delivery.
- Previous experience performing receptionist duties such as check-in/out, front desk management, and clerical tasks.
- Understanding of reservation procedures, room assignments, and booking software.
- Professional telephone manner with confidence managing calls and guest requests.
- Strong spoken and written communication abilities.
- Hospitality or customer service experience is highly advantageous.
- Availability to work flexible hours including evenings, weekends, and holidays.
- Basic computer literacy; familiarity with hotel property management systems (PMS) is beneficial.
- Completion of high school education or its equivalent; additional hospitality training preferred.
- Strong problem-solving aptitude, attention to detail, and the ability to maintain composure under pressure.
